#4fab5d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4fab5d is composed of 31% red, 67.1%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 45.6%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 129.1 degrees, a saturation of 36.8% and a lightness of 49%. #4fab5d color hex could be obtained by blending #9effba with #005700.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

Shades and Tints of #4fab5d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050a05 is the darkest color, while #fcfd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#4fab5d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#758578 is the less saturated color, while #02f827 is the most saturated one.
